How to prune aglaonema nitidum

Best time
Any time for cosmetic leaf removal
How often
Rarely — as needed for tidiness
Technique
Snip petioles cleanly near the main stem using sterile scissors or a sharp blade. Remove flower stalks early if foliage growth is the priority.

How often does aglaonema nitidum need pruning?

Rarely — as needed for tidiness. Aglaonema nitidum is among the least pruning-dependent houseplants. Remove yellowed or damaged leaves at the petiole base as they appear. Occasional flower spathes can be removed at the base to direct energy into its glossy dark-green foliage. The plant is naturally upright and does not require shaping.
